MOCA for Android

MOCA for Android is an application to keep MOCA attendees up-to-date with events, infos and yells from their fine hosts.

The application is available on the Google Play Store.

Requirements

Rebuilding the application from scratch requires a working Android SDK installation for API Level 16 (Android 4.1), Maven 3.0 or later and android-maven-plugin.

You also going to need to perform some one-time initialization of your build environment, see BUILDING.md for more information.
